Sodium Lauryl Sulfate vs. Natural Surfactants: A Comparison

The debate around cleansing agents frequently centers on Sodium Lauryl Sulfate (SLS) versus alternative surfactants. SLS, a prevalent synthetic ingredient, provides excellent cleaning power but is often criticized with dryness in some people . Conversely, natural surfactants, such as sugar-based cleansers, are derived from natural sources and are generally considered milder on the skin . Yet, their foaming ability may be less intense than SLS, and their manufacturing can sometimes involve complex methods . Ultimately , the ideal choice is based on individual skin condition and personal preference .

Methylated Seed Oil, Alkyl Polyglucoside & Cocamidopropyl Betaine: The New Cleansing Stars

The personal care industry is constantly searching for gentler, more eco-friendly cleansing components . Enter three popular stars: Methylated Seed Oil, Alkyl Polyglucoside, and Cocamidopropyl Betaine. These are revolutionizing the way we approach cleansing. Methylated Seed Oil, often derived from rapeseed or sunflower, offers exceptional emolliency and assists in soften skin. Alkyl Polyglucoside, a gentle sugar-based surfactant, offers effective cleansing minus harshness, and Cocamidopropyl Betaine, an dual-action surfactant, adds foam and increases the complete cleansing experience.

Combined , these impressive ingredients are redefining of kind skincare.
